In a proactive stride toward public well-being, the Environmental Health and Sanitation Unit, alongside Zoomlion Ketu North, has launched a crucial desilting exercise around the Dzodze Dzesime roundabout. This initiative forms a key part of the department’s mission to control environmental factors that negatively impact health, ensuring a clean and safe environment for all community members.





The joint effort is strategically aimed at preventing localized flooding and mitigating the risk of waterborne diseases that thrive in stagnant water. By clearing the silt, the partners are actively promoting better environmental sanitation and upholding community health through essential maintenance and preventative action.
